Maine postcard finally delivered after 64 years

[October 20, 2010]  FARMINGTON, Maine (AP) -- A former student at the Farmington State Teacher's College in Maine now has a postcard that was sent to her in the fall of 1946.

The postcard, a thank you note, was sent to Ruth Webber at Purington Hall by "Gert and Charlie." It was mailed from Winthrop.

The postcard showed up recently in the mailroom at the University of Maine at Farmington. Mailroom employee Andrea Butterfield says the postcard was in mint condition and the ink wasn't faded. It had a 1 cent stamp on it.

The Sun Journal of Lewiston said there's no explanation about where the card has been.

On Monday 83-year-old Ruth Webber McGary, received the card. She said she worked with the Charlie who sent the card, but doesn't remember why it was sent.
